# About the Miro connector

> Miro, previously known as RealtimeBoard, offers an easy-to-use platform for visual
collaboration and whiteboard activities, designed to cater to the needs of teams from
various functional areas.

:::note
This connector is built by UiPath and receives official support selectively. The connector supports a limited set of commonly used APIs for the target application and may cover most typical use cases. Also, they are retained in a stable state until the requirements for a new version release are met.
